Problem
Existing systems fail to provide personalized and timely warnings about environmental events, such as weather changes or natural phenomena, to individuals with specific health conditions, leading to unnecessary warnings and potential health risks.
Innovation Solution
A system that uses mobile terminals to gather and analyze location information, health profiles, and environmental data to predict and send targeted warnings to individuals, including dynamic queries to assess their situation and provide individualized instructions, thereby minimizing gratuitous warnings and ensuring timely preparation for potential health threats.

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Reliability
If general environmental warnings are sent to all users, then coverage is improved, but warning accuracy deteriorates due to gratuitous warnings
Solution Approach 1:
The system applies local quality by customizing warning content according to individual user profiles and their specific health conditions, locations, and predicted movements. Each user receives tailored warnings relevant to their personal situation rather than generic alerts, thereby eliminating gratuitous warnings while maintaining comprehensive coverage.
Solution Approach 2:
The system performs preliminary actions by analyzing user profiles, health data, and movement patterns in advance to predict future locations and assess vulnerability to environmental events. This pre-analysis enables the system to send only necessary warnings before environmental events occur, avoiding unnecessary alerts while ensuring timely notifications.
2Reliability
If personalized warning analysis is implemented, then warning relevance is improved, but system compl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The system segments the complex task of personalized warning generation into distinct functional modules: user profile management, location tracking, movement pattern analysis, environmental event monitoring, and warning generation. This modular segmentation reduces overall system complexity while maintaining high warning relevance through specialized processing in each module.
Solution Approach 2:
The system implements self-service by automatically collecting and analyzing user data, predicting movements, and generating personalized warnings without requiring manual intervention. This automation reduces operational complexity while improving warning relevance through continuous data-driven analysis of user behavior and environmental conditions.

AI summary
A system for warning a party provided with a terminal comprises databases of profile information of the party, environment information of a geographical location, and location information of the terminal. The system is adapted to, based on location information of the terminal,to checkwhether the terminal locates within said geographical location, and if yes, to analyse profile information of the party so that if profile information comprises a parameter which matches with a corresponding parameter of environment information of a geographical location, a warning message is sent to the terminal in order to warn the party.
